Presented by Harbourfront Centre in partnership with York’s Faculty of Fine Arts, Immersions 2003 offers encounters with artists and cultures featured in Harbourfront’s flagship festival, “World’s Fare: The Americas Now”, which will run for the two extended “weekends” of July 10-13 and July 18-20. 


Immersions sessions take place Wednesday, 6-9 p.m. and Saturday & Sunday, 11am-1 pm. Here is the line-up.



Immersions 1 with host Rodrigo Chavez


Discover the dynamic cultural collisions behind music and dance traditions of the Americas with host Rodrigo Chavez.


Known for his popular workshops on Afro-Latin music, Chilean-born Chavez studied guitar and percussion with masters in Argentina, Cuba, Venezuela, Peru and Bolivia. He is artistic director of Cassava Latin Rhythms, a Toronto-based band specializing in contemporary Latin-Canadian music.

Immersions 2 with host Santee Smith


Celebrate life through song and dance, and give thanks to the food spirits with host Santee Smith (left), a member of the Mohawk Nation, Turtle Clan from Six Nations, Ontario, who works as a choreographer, dancer, musician and pottery designer.


 


Right: “Turtle Family’ – Pottery by Santee Smith


Trained at the National Ballet School, she is currently working toward an MA in dance at York University. From 1997 to 2001 she participated in the Aboriginal Dance Project, Chinook Winds, at the Banff Centre for the Arts.
